Position Information:

The Receptionist will greet, assist, and provide information to community members, visitors, and other guests of the organization. This position operates the District's central telephone switchboard and greets building visitors. The position schedules conference room use, coordinates the posting of community e-fliers, and provides clerical support to Community Relations staff and other departments as required.

Shift Details: 7 hours a day; 220 day calendar

Continuing Position: Employees have reasonable assurance of continued employment to the following school year. However, an employee's total work hours, work locations, and the designated beginning and ending times may vary.

FLSA Status: Non-exempt

Hourly Rate: $37.48(hourly) (2026-2027Office Personnel Salary Schedule)

Position Type/Level: Office Personnel Level C

Benefits:

The Washington State Health Care Authority (HCA) provides access to health care services. Our benefits are provided to eligible positions through SEBB (School Employees Benefits Board). Eligibility for SEBB state health insurance coverage is determined by working 630 hours during the school year.

Eligibility for a state retirement plan through the Department of Retirement Systems (DRS) is determined upon hire and is based on a variety of factors.
